Hi seniors!

I have received a standard letter from my previous employer stating my job position, start and end dates, but no work hours, salary or responsibilities.
For these, I have reached out to the person who was my manager at the time, and who lives in a different country (neither of us still work at the company). They have agreed to write the letter for me. My questions are:

1) Is notarization a necessity for this letter? Since I have a minimal info letter from the employer on their letter head.
2) If yes, can I get the notarization done through a remote (online) notary services, probably located in a third country? I am doing this to lessen the burden on my ex-manager, because they live in a country where availing notary services is not easy and straightforward.

Thank you in advance!

I haven't heard about notarization of job reference letter. The main thing is that it should be on company letter head, covers all your job responsibilities and the contact number of the manager. Why to get job reference letter notary attested??? Its usually gov docs.

I have mentioned that the manager no longer works at the company, and would therefore be unable to provide the document on the company letter head. It would be printed on white paper. This is why I am asking whether notarization would be needed.

Doesn't matter. No.
Technically the company needs to offer you a letter whether the manager you were working with work there or not. Your employment was with the company not the manager. This is how it works, the company has to vouch that you worked for them.
